Ahrefs Study Reveals 58% CTR Drop from AI Overviews

Ahrefs ran fresh numbers. They analyzed 300,000 keywords through Google Search Console data. Half the keywords triggered AI Overviews on informational intent. The other half stayed traditional. They compared click-through rates from December 2023—before AI Overviews existed—to December 2025 after global rollout. The verdict is brutal. AI Overviews steal clicks by giving full answers right on the results page. Users stay put. Websites lose out.

Position-one pages on AI Overview keywords now average only 1.6% CTR. Back in 2023 that number stood at 7.3%. That means a 58% drop. For every 100 visitors a top result used to get, Google now keeps 58. Only 42 make it through to the site. The damage spreads down the page. Position two loses 50.8%. Position three drops 46.4%. Even position ten sees a 19.4% reduction. AI is quietly stealing visibility from the entire SERP.

How the Impact Grew Worse Over Time

The first Ahrefs snapshot came in April 2025. At that point AI Overviews already shaved 34.5% off position-one CTR. By December 2025 the hit climbed to 58%. Coverage spread to dozens more countries. More languages joined. Users got comfortable with instant answers. The habit stuck. Clicks kept vanishing. Independent reports echo the trend. Some peg the loss at 61% for pure informational queries. Paid ads feel the squeeze too in certain verticals.

AI Overviews now dominate informational searches. They show up almost every time someone asks “what is” or “how to.” They pull content from the top web results over 99% of the time. Yet almost none of that traffic flows back to the source. Search inches closer to zero-click territory. Google answers the question. The user never leaves.

What This Means for SEO Jobs and Strategies

SEO specialists watch their world change fast. Ranking number one still counts. But real visibility now depends on appearing inside the AI Overview box. Content must prove deep expertise. Fresh data, unique insights, and strong E-E-A-T signals push you higher in AI picks. Thin, generic answer pages get crushed hardest. Quick-fact lookups and basic definitions lose traffic overnight.

Jobs evolve too. Classic keyword chasing and on-page tweaks shrink in value when traffic dries up. New demand surges for AI-specific skills. Pros track which brands and pages get cited in AI responses. They optimize for snippet inclusion. They build authority across social, forums, and video. They pull visitors straight from email lists, apps, or other platforms. Teams that move early test tactics to win AI citations. They spread risk beyond Google. Those who ignore the shift face steep declines.

Major publishers already report 50%+ organic drops in some categories. Remaining visitors often show higher intent. But sheer volume crashes. Google keeps scaling AI. It serves billions of queries monthly. Some forecasts say AI-powered search traffic could pass traditional organic by 2028.
